| blib/lib/Heap/MinMax.pm | |||
|---|---|---|---|
| Criterion | Covered | Total | % |
| subroutine | 32 | 42 | 76.1 |
| pod | 13 | 39 | 33.3 |
| line | count | pod | subroutine |
|---|---|---|---|
| 20 | 1 | n/a | BEGIN |
| 21 | 1 | n/a | BEGIN |
| 22 | 1 | n/a | BEGIN |
| 33 | 3 | Yes | new |
| 51 | 0 | Yes | array |
| 77 | 0 | Yes | build_heap |
| 102 | 13 | Yes | insert |
| 130 | 0 | Yes | remove |
| 177 | 3 | Yes | min |
| 201 | 2 | Yes | pop_min |
| 233 | 0 | Yes | min_non_zero |
| 282 | 0 | Yes | pop_min_non_zero |
| 331 | 2 | Yes | max |
| 371 | 1 | Yes | pop_max |
| 420 | 3 | No | trickledown |
| 455 | 3 | No | trickledown_min |
| 497 | 1 | No | trickledown_max |
| 532 | 18 | No | bubble_up |
| 577 | 5 | No | bubble_up_min |
| 602 | 11 | No | bubble_up_max |
| 624 | 16 | No | swap |
| 646 | 3 | No | get_smallest_descendant_index |
| 727 | 1 | No | get_largest_descendant_index |
| 812 | 24 | No | default_cmp_func |
| 825 | 0 | No | default_eval |
| 832 | 57 | No | parent_node_index |
| 845 | 1 | No | grandparent_node_index |
| 860 | 10 | No | right_node |
| 873 | 26 | No | right_node_index |
| 881 | 13 | No | left_node |
| 894 | 30 | No | left_node_index |
| 902 | 1 | No | parent |
| 920 | 0 | Yes | get_size |
| 927 | 0 | No | is_empty |
| 938 | 16 | No | has_grandparent |
| 953 | 18 | No | has_parent |
| 963 | 4 | No | has_children |
| 973 | 3 | No | is_grandchild |
| 1002 | 25 | No | get_level |
| 1025 | 0 | Yes | |
| 1029 | 0 | No | print_heap |
| 1047 | 24 | No | fp_equal |